Activating Feng Shui Cures and Enhancers
Treating your Old Cures and Enhancers
One needs to check your old feng shui cures
at least once a year to see if they are still in good shape. You
may check for an auspicious day to change those cures if it is convenient
to you. If you are too busy to do that according to good dates,
then you can ignore the date selection process. But please do NOT
intentionally do it on a bad day after you checking them. Else,
your mind will carry doubtful thoughts which will affect the energies
of your surroundings.
If there are signs of retirement indicated,
then one should dispose them by wrapping them in red paper or red
plastic bags respectively. When disposing them, whisper some kind
words of appreciation thanking them for protecting you. The best
is to bury them into soil or throwing them into the sea. But for
city dwellers, it is probably too hard to find a place to dig a
hole on the ground or find the sea.
As a rule of thumb, cures used to remedy bad stars should be disposed away in case they have expired. But you may still keep the enhancers used to activate the good stars. New cures always work better, no doubt about that!
If they are still in excellent shape, then you can actually revitalize
their energies by smoking them with genuine sandalwood incense
sticks. If the items allow you to use water to clean, then you
can wipe them with slight water and cloth. But never soak them
into water or wash them under running tap.
Then check the directions to see if they are still suitable for
the placement of those old cures and enhancers. If they are not,
you can either keep them in a box in your storeroom for future
use. If they are still useful, then display them in the correct
directions and locations.

Creating Intention
The cures and enhancers will work more effectively if you focus
your intention by whispering it to the cures and enhancers so
that the desired outcome is more likely to occur. Having said
that, feng shui cures work whether you perform them with focus
intention or not, but if you want maximum results, then give them
your full attention, else they will work weakly! Intention is
the combination of motivation, desire, will and goal setting to
create a change. You must know exactly what you want, visualize
the desired results and expect the results to happen! These will
then formulate the words you say to the cures and enhancers. The
clarity with which you visualize an intention makes your goal
more likely to happen as you foresee it. Detailed visualization
directs the subconscious mind, the chi, the universe, and your
own belief system to create the life scenarios you desire.
Method of Empowering
The "ang pow" (red packet) tradition has long been practiced
throughout Chinese history and stems from chinese culture and
folklore. Red is known to be the most auspicous color and powerful
color to ward off misfortune. One can actually empower your enhancers
and cures by placing them with an "ang pow" below them.
The "ang pow" has to be filled up with money notes (say
USD2, USD10, USD12 etc). This is called "ya sui qian"
which literally means to "press down evil". On top of
that, one also can write down not only what you want, but why
you want it and how intently you want it to fill inside the angpow.
Another secret element of empowerment is to use sacred mantras
or taoist incantation. It is like sealing a deal with certainty
where your actions, thoughts, attitudes and new life situation
are all aligned together. Such empowerment is also known as annointment
(or "kai kwong" in chinese). This will greatly magnify
your cures and enhancers which sits on your table or floor. You
